Happy Retirement Flower Girl

Happy Retirement Flower Girl
Making this card for my daughter's Morale teacher who is retiring next week.

I am making a mini card, size of a gift card as I plan to put this card inside a gift bag with a small present. Thus, I keep this card clean and simple due to its limited size.

Close-up: The girl holding the bunch of flowers
First, a girl holding a bunch of flowers image is stamped on a white card stock and colored using Copic markers. Then, it is attached onto a red-pink plaid pattern paper.

Close-up: Sentiment on vellum
The sentiment is customized using alphabet stamp and stamped onto a vellum. It is attached onto the girl image at the bottom. Then, the whole panel is attached onto a green card base.

Close-up: Shimmer of the flowers and pink flower shaped gem
As final touch, some shimmer is added to the flowers and a pink flower shaped gem is attached onto the girl head.

Faux Watercolor Happy Retirement

Faux Watercolor Happy Retirement
Made this card for my daughter's school's afternoon session senior principal assistant retirement. She is also happens to be my daughter's Art teacher. By the way, she looks young and I did not think she is at the age of retirement!

Atlantic Hearts Sketch Challenge - Sketch #71
I adopt the sketch from Atlantic Hearts Sketch Challenge - Sketch #71 as shown above as I want to try out the faux watercolor background technique introduced by Jennifer Mcguire. Since I am trying out, I opt for smaller space which the sketch is perfect for my experiment. Another reason I want to try out this technique on this card is because the senior principal assistant is an Art teacher in which I want to relate something artistry in the card.

Close-up : Faux watercolor flower 'painting'
I stamp the flower image on a watercolor paper and heat emboss with white embossing powder. Then, I smudge some distress inks onto the watercolor paper and spray water onto it as in Jennifer's video. I let it dry and the result is amazing. I really like this faux watercolor or 'painting' look!

Close-up : Sentiment and quicklet eyelets
On a yellow card base, a variety of colors stripes pattern papers is trimmed and attached onto it as in sketch follow by the faux watercolor image. The sentiment is customized using alphabets and stamped on a pink strip. Two (2) red quicklet eyelets are secured to the right edge of the sentiment to add some texture. It is attached onto the card using pop dots for some dimension.

Close-up : Pink gems
For final touch-up, three (3) pink gems are attached to the right upper corner as in sketch.

Happy Retirement Official Retiree's Decision Maker

Happy Retirement Official Retiree's Decision Maker
Made this funny card for one of my manager who is retiring next week. Everyone is scare of him not because he is fierce but for his non-stop talkativeness! I was once felt that way too but after a few "session" with him, what he talks about is actually very informative and useful. He once even guide me how to climb up the organization career path. I just feel blessed that I know him.


Mojo Monday 336
This card layout is inspirational from Mojo Monday 336 sketch/challenge as shown above.

A scallop circle is die cut from a yellow card stock to make the base of the spin wheel. It is then stamped with the activities using custom alphabets. The spin wheel title, 'Official Retiree's Decision Maker' is printed on a yellow card stock as the title has too much characters to be custom stamped. It is later die cut into circle. A custom arrow is made from green card stock and 'Spin Me' is stamped near to the tip of the arrow. Finally, the spin wheel is assemble and secured using a silver brad.


Close-up : Official Retiree's Decision Maker spin wheel
The spin wheel is attached onto the same green card stock that made the arrow. It is attached onto another orange card stock after that. Finally, it is attached onto the light yellow card base. The sentiment, 'Happy Retirement' is stamped in two (2) part at the top and bottom of the spin wheel.

Retirement Message/Scrapbook #1 (Sample)

A retirement message/scrapbook made for some retirement messages writing.


The front and back covers are using 8"x8" cardboard. The background of the front cover are  wrapped with a balloon themed wrapper. The message of "Happy Retirement to [the person's name]" is made with individual lettering made from different shapes, fronts and designs. Each of the lettering is pop-up to give the front cover some texture.

Inside the front cover, it is centered by a gold card with two (2) stripes of purple-pink mesh. It is then layered with the message of "Best Wishes from All of Us" with "Us" layered with a pink heart-shaped.

There are nine pages in total for the message writing page whereby each pages have both combination of different colors, shapes and sizes of circle, star, triangle, heart, pentagon, square and etc from Farewell Message/Scrapbook #1 and rectangular or square 'pockets' of different sizes from Farewell Message/Scrapbook #2. These shapes and 'pockets' are decorated with different style of placement to accommodate each of the shapes and sizes in that particular page. These 'pockets' are made from various design wrappers that themed "Best Wishes" and "Thank You" and "Thanks".

P/S : For more information on the writing page design(s), please refer to Farewell Message/Scrapbook #1 and Farewell Message/Scrapbook #2.

The back cover is wrapped with "Thank You" and "Thanks" wrapper. The inside of back cover, it is centered by a gold card with scattered decorated messages of "Thank You" and "Thanks" cut from the wrapper. Some of the messages are pop-up to give some texture. The back cover end with scrapper signature.

The covers and pages is secured  using 1" Gold Zutter Bind It All Owire Bindings.
